Ingredients
These Baja Fish Tacos loaded with cilantro lime slaw, zesty Avocado Crema, and fresh Pico de Gallo! The perfect healthy dinner recipe everyone in your family will love!
For the Fish
- 2 lbs. cod filets
- 2 tablespoons avocado o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
- 1/4 teaspoon ancho chili powder
- 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
For the Tortillas
- 16 corn tortillas
- cooking spray
For the Slaw
- 2 cups green cabbage, thinly sliced
- 2 cups purple cabbage, thinly sliced
- 2 tablespoons lime juice
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
- 1 teaspoon honey
- salt & pepper to taste
For the Avocado Crema
- 2 avocados
- 1 garlic clove
- 1/4 cup fresh cilantro
- 1/4 teaspoon cumin
- 1/8 teaspoon red pepper flakes
- 1 1/2 tablespoon lime juice
- 2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- salt to taste
How to Make Baja Fish Tacos Recipe
Step 1: Prepare the Fish
- In a bowl, mix together avocado oil, garlic powder, smoked paprika, ground cumin, sea salt, ancho chili powder, and black pepper.
- Coat the cod filets in the spice mixture evenly.
Step 2: Cook the Fish
-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at.
- Add cooking spray.
- Place fish in the skillet and cook for about 3-4 minutes on each side or until fully cooked.
Step 3: Make the Cilantro Lime Slaw
- In a large mixing bowl, combine sliced green cabbage, purple cabbage, lime juice, chopped cilantro, honey, salt, and pepper.
- Toss well until all ingredients are mixed thoroughly.
Step 4: Prepare Avocado Crema
- In another mixing bowl or blender, mash avocados with garlic clove and cilantro.
- Add cumin, red pepper flakes, lime juice, red wine vinegar, olive oil, and salt. Blend until smooth.
Step 5: Assemble Tacos
- Warm corn tortillas in a skillet or microwave.
- Layer fish on each tortilla followed by cilantro lime slaw and a drizzle of avocado crema.
- Optionally top with fresh pico de gallo before serving.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When preparing your Baja Fish Tacos, it’s easy to make a few common mistakes. Here are some tips to ensure your tacos turn out perfectly.
- Skipping the seasoning: Not seasoning the fish properly can lead to bland tacos. Make sure to use all the spices listed in the recipe for maximum flavor.
- Overcooking the fish: Cooking the cod for too long can make it dry. Keep an eye on the fish and remove it from heat as soon as it flakes easily with a fork.
- Not warming the tortillas: Cold tortillas can ruin the taco experience. Warm them in a skillet or microwave before serving to enhance their flavor and texture.
- Ignoring freshness: Using stale ingredients like old avocados or wilted cabbage affects taste and nutrition. Always opt for fresh produce when making your slaw and crema.
- Neglecting toppings: Toppings like Pico de Gallo or Avocado Crema add essential flavor and texture. Don’t skip these elements; they complete your Baja Fish Tacos!
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ftover Baja Fish Tacos in an airtight container.
- They will last for up to 3 days in the refrigerator.
- Keep components separate if possible, especially the slaw and crema, to maintain freshness.
Freezing Baja Fish Tacos Recipe
- You can freeze cooked fish for up to 2 months.
- Use freezer-safe containers or bags to prevent freezer burn.
- It’s best to freeze without toppings; add fresh toppings when reheating.
Reheating Baja Fish Tacos Recipe
-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place tacos on a baking sheet and heat for about 10-15 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Place tacos on a microwave-safe plate. Heat for 30-60 seconds, checking frequently not to make them soggy.
- Stovetop: Heat a skillet over medium heat. Add tacos and warm each side for about 2-3 minutes until heated through.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the best fish for Baja Fish Tacos Recipe?
The best fish for Baja Fish Tacos is typically white fish like cod or tilapia due to their mild flavor and flaky texture.
Can I make Baja Fish Tacos 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are components like slaw and crema ahead of time. However, it’s best to cook the fish just before serving.
How do I customize my Baja Fish Tacos Recipe?
You can customize your tacos by adding different toppings like mango salsa, jalapeños, or even using shrimp instead of fish.
What sides pair well with Baja Fish Tacos?
Great sides include Mexican rice, refried beans, or a simple green salad that complements the flavors of the tacos.
How spicy are these Baja Fish Tacos?
The spice level depends on how much ancho chili powder you use. You can adjust it according to your preference for heat.
